Plastic Gutter Repair in Longmont, CO
Plastic gutter rep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ged sections of a property's gutter system to ensure proper drainage and prevent water damage. These projects typically include repairing leaks, cracks, or holes, as well as reattaching loose or sagging gutters. Homeowners often request this service after noticing issues such as overflowing gutters, water pooling near the foundation, or visible damage following storms or years of wear. Understanding the extent of damage and the specific type of gutter material can help property owners determine wh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ement might be necessary.
Before requesting plastic gutter repair, property owners should assess the condition of their existing gutters and consider factors like the age of the system, the presence of persistent leaks, or corrosion. It’s useful to know if the gutters are part of a larger drainage system that directs water away from the home’s foundation. Clear communication about the specific issues, the type of gutter material, and any previous repairs can assist in determining the most effective repair approach. Properly maintained gutters are essential for protecting a property from water-related damage and ensuring effective water runoff.

Common Plastic Gutter Repair Jobs
Plastic gutter repair involves fixing cracks, leaks, and broken sections to ensure proper water flow.
Gutter sealant application helps prevent leaks and extends the lifespan of damaged plastic gutters.
Section replacement involves removing and installing new plastic gutter segments to restore functionality.
Fastener and bracket repair addresses loose or broken mounting hardware to stabilize gutters.
Downspout repair includes fixing or replacing damaged sections to ensure effective water drainage.
Gutter cleaning and inspection identify potential issues before they lead to costly repairs.
Plastic Gutter Repair Questions
What types of damage can occur to plastic gutters? Common issues include cracks, warping, and leaks caused by weather exposure or debris buildup.
How can I tell if my plastic gutters need repair? Signs include sagging, water overflowing, or visible cracks and breaks along the gutter length.
Are plastic gutter repairs permanent? Repairs can effectively address specific damage, but ongoing exposure may require replacement for long-term durability.
What maintenance helps prevent plastic gutter damage? Regular cleaning and inspection help identify issues early and reduce the risk of cracks and leaks.
